This five-bedroom terraced house is located at 14 West Parade, CT21 6BX. It offers two bathrooms and around 188 m² of floor space. The property holds an EPC rating of D. Land Registry records a sale at £20,500 in July 1995. Nearby shops include Iceland Hythe, Waitrose Hythe, Sainsburys Hythe and Aldi Dymchurch, the closest about 640 m away. The nearest stations are Hythe Station, Sandling Railway Station and Westenhanger Railway Station, around 983 m away. The Environment Agency rates this address at high risk of flooding.
